Danny wants to buy a truck in 4 years. He is going to put away $2,500.00 into his savings account that will pay him 6.75% intere
aniked [119]

Answer:

b $3,272.43

Step-by-step explanation:

A = p(1+r/n)^nt

Where

A= future value

P= principal = $2500

r= interest rate = 6.75% = 0.0675

n = number of periods = 12

t = time = 4 years

A = p(1+r/n)^nt

= 2500(1+0.0675/12)^12*4

= 2500(1+0.005625)^48

= 2500(1.005625)^48

= 2500(1.3089737859257)

= 3272.4344648144

Approximately

A= $3272.43

He will have $3272.43 to give as down payment in 4 years
